Skinny Vinny Imperiati | Maintaining Sobriety, Following Dreams, Meeting Hero‘s, Zackass & Relationships

We catch up with Skinny Vinny Imperiati and hear about his new relationship & how it is for him now that he's sober. He details how he maintains his mental health, sobriety, and workload in a productive way. He's had some moments where he thought he might relapse but worked through them with a great support system. Now, Vinny is focused on his health & mental well-being.

Since we last checked in with Vinny, a lot has changed. When we first talked to him in February of this year, he was living in Connecticut. After staying in a sober-living house for over 3 years, He had a crazy idea to buy a ranch and have his own space. He was able to stay sober, find work & stay in treatment. He did it for a while, but it just didn't work out in the long term. Now he's living in LA and focusing on his podcasting, film & content work.

Recently, Vinny started his own podcast production company. He's helping out a lot of his friends in the skating community to start their own podcasts. He also has some filming projects in the works, including the upcoming "Zackass" style, show that he tells some of the first details about. He hopes he can be a beacon for positivity and change with his friends and community and hopes to help anyone he can in the coming new year.
